Ever felt like navigating bureaucracy is a maze? The recent EU regulations aimed at curbing the trade of stolen artifacts have left antique dealers entangled in an overwhelming web of red tape. While the intention behind protecting cultural heritage is commendable, the practical implications for the art market are nothing short of chaotic. This situation raises important questions about the balance between security and accessibility in the art world. Shouldn't regulations also support the very livelihoods they seek to protect? How can we advocate for a system that fosters both ethical trade and creativity in art?
